The Director of Nursing RN - Pediatric Homecare supervises and manages clinical skilled home care staff to deliver high-quality pediatric home health services. This role involves coordinating client care plans, ensuring compliance with medical and regulatory standards, and fostering strong relationships with clients, caregivers, and medical personnel. The position also includes EMR management, staff training, and on-call responsibilities to maintain exceptional service delivery.

Position Purpose:
Under the supervision of the Area Director of Clinical Services, this position exists to act as the supervising nurse to manage the clinical skilled home care staff and to provide the highest quality of care and service for our patients. The Director of Nursing position will also work with other team members to establish Care Options For Kids as the provider of choice for clients, caregivers, and referral sources in the region by managing staff to provide excellent customer service, coordinating client services, and forging strong client and caregiver relationships.
